The Java Collections Framework was a major addition in JDK 1.2. The process of generifying an API is complex. Apache Bundle wrapping Apache Commons Collections containing types that extend and augment the Java Collections Framework. This version uses the generics features of Java 5 and is not compatible with earlier JDK versions. Collections are based on the ICollection interface, the IList interface, the IDictionary interface. Types that extend and augment the Java Collections Framework. For commons-collections version 3, there is no groupId: org.apache.commons.collections, so prior to version 4 use commons-collections:commons-collections. Note that the artifact id has changed to commons-collections4. Commons Collections. My project has a few library dependencies depending again on Apache commons collection 3.2.1 which is vulnerable. License: Apache 2.0: Categories: Collections: Tags: collections structures: Used By: 5,419 artifacts. The LoggerFactory from the Slf4J library is returned in a method, but there's no use of the common-collections library, making it a candidate for removal. Reference: https://issues.apache.org/jira/browse/COLLECTIONS-382. Commons-Collections seek to build upon the JDK classes by providing new interfaces, implementations and utilities. Common Public License Version 1.0: JUnit Commons collections is a project to develop and maintain collection classes based on and inspired by the JDK collection framework.